Weapons Prohibition. Contractor shall prohibit, and shall require its subcontractors to prohibit, its employees from carrying weapons, including concealed weapons, in the course of performance of work under this Contract, other than while at the Contractor’s or subcontractor’s own business premises. This requirement shall apply to vehicles used at any City work site and vehicles used to perform any work under this Contract, except vehicles that are an employee’s “own motor vehicle” pursuant to Wis. Stat. sec. 175.60(15m).
